Manchester United's Juan Mata admitted he was "embarrassed" after concluding his first season at Old Trafford. The Spaniard swapped Chelsea for the Red Devils midway through the season in a £37m deal.
David Moyes was in charge at that point but poor results and performances saw him axed less than a year into a six-year deal.
Ryan Giggs saw the season through with a defeat to relegation threatened Sunderland and a win over Hull their final two home outings.
And as the United players thanked their fans on the pitch Mata concedes he struggled to face the fans. He told the club's website: “We were in seventh position in the league, a position Manchester United should never be in. "I was like I'm going to wave and they're going to boos us
